Cyprus: Bomb hoax in many schools – See the threatening message they received

It was sent from an email with an IP address abroad and likely originated from an automatic translation of text into English

Newsroom May 17 01:04

A bomb threat message was sent today to many schools across Cyprus, causing disruption but not significant concern, as it was understood that it wasn’t true.

Specifically, the threatening message, which had the same content, was sent via email to numerous schools, including kindergartens, primary schools, middle schools, and high schools throughout Cyprus.

Investigations revealed that the bomb threat email was sent from an IP address abroad.

The text was identical and likely originated from an automatic translation of a message from English.

Many schools, after communicating with the Police and the Ministry of Education, sent reassuring messages to the parents of the students, informing them that the schools are in contact with the authorities and that there is no cause for concern.

In some other schools, parents received a message stating that, following instructions from the Police and the Ministry, the children are remaining in the school yard until further notice.

In Paphos, bomb disposal experts conducted checks on all the schools without finding anything.
